Contract Scotland Scoops UK Wide Construction Industry Award

Scottish construction, property & engineering recruitment specialists Contract Scotland scooped a major national construction industry award last week at the inaugural UK Construction Investing in Talent Awards.

Recognising that ムconstruction is all about people’, an eye-catching panel of HR and talent experts from both inside and outside of the construction industry scrutinised entries from every corner of the UK, before announcing the winners at a glittering ceremony held at the Grosvenor House Hotel in London’s Mayfair on December 8th.

In what was a competitive category to identify the UK construction industry’s Best Recruitment Consultancy, Stirling-based Contract Scotland were singled out by the Judges as clear winners, thanks to their continued ムemphasis on quality’ throughout the recruitment process and across their entire operation.ᅠ The Judges were also impressed by the firm’s commitment to diversity amongst their candidate base and their work supporting graduates, undergraduates and those wanting to return to the construction industry, via their Social Enterprise, Constructing Futures.

John-Paul Toner, Operations Director at Contract Scotland, said “While we’ve been recognised at both recruitment & general business awards in the past, what makes this one so special is that itᅠis recognition from the construction industry itself.ᅠ To be acknowledged by the industry sector we serve as delivering a “best in class” recruitment service is testimony to the years of hard work and commitment of the team we’ve built at Contract Scotland. Talent attraction and retention are of ever increasing importance to our clients and non-clients alike, and to be endorsed by the industry as its recruiter of choice for our approach to addressing those challenges is very rewarding. This award comes at the end of what will be the most successful year in our 26-year history, and is the perfect way to finish the year.”

Associate Director Alan Shave added “The judges asked us to demonstrate how we deliver successful outcomes for all of our candidates & clients, as well as evidence of strong client feedback, a track record of repeat business and long-term success, so we’re thrilled that they recognised our achievements. ᅠIt’s a huge team effort that everyone can be proud of, and I can’t wait to build on the success with further growth in 2017!”

Contract Scotland is now in its 27th year of operation and employs 40 staff at their headquarters in Stirling. This year will see turnover grow for the 7th consecutive year and is projected to exceed ᆪ20m for the first time. Further expansion of both headcount and turnover is planned in 2017 as the company aims to take advantage of increased demand in both their core sectors and in the various support functions such as Finance, Marketing, IT and Administration, as construction firms increasingly turn to them for assistance in recruiting for these disciplines.
